It’s preseason but it’ll have the look of the playoffs. The NFL’s slate of 11 nationally televised preseason games will feature all 12 2008 playoff teams, one of the highlights of the 2009 NFL preseason schedule announced today. Among those games is a rematch of Super Bowl XLIII with the world champion Pittsburgh Steelers hosting the Arizona Cardinals on Thursday, August 13 (ESPN, 8:00 PM ET).

The contest will take place six months after Pittsburgh defeated Arizona 27-23 at Raymond James Stadium in one of the most exciting Super Bowls of all time. Traditional Les Paul performance with a modern, no-frills attitude. Introduced nearly 25 years ago as a guitar for the studio musician, the Les Paul Studio has become one of the most desired Les Pauls for its tremendous harmonic and sonic capacities.

’50s Rounded Neck Profile
The traditional ’50s neck profile — found on the Les Paul Studio — is a thicker, rounder profile, emulating the neck shapes of the iconic 1958 and 1959 Les Paul Standards. The neck is machined in Gibson’s rough mill using wood shapers to make the initial cuts. Read the rest of this entry »

A total of 32 compensatory choices in the 2009 NFL Draft have been awarded to 16 teams, the NFL announced today.

Under terms of the NFL Collective Bargaining Agreement, a team losing more or better compensatory free agents than it acquires in the previous year is eligible to receive compensatory draft picks.

The number of picks a team receives equals the net loss of compensatory free agents up to a maximum of four. Read the rest of this entry »
